Description: He was not the biggest, or the strongest, or the fastest. And yet, Wayne Gretzky is without question the greatest hockey player of all time. In light of number 99's retirement in '99, here is an easy-to-read look back at Gretzky's utterly amazing career -- as he shattered long-standing records at an unbelievable rate, led the Edmonton Oilers to four Stanley Cup Championships, won a record nine MVP awards, and changed the game forever. Illustrated with lots of great Gretzky photos in addition to artwork, the book is also jam-packed with biographical information on the man himself. A great athlete, a great sportsman, and a great guy, Gretzky will always be known simply as "The Great One".
